Abstract :
Using forward error correction (FEC) technology and erbium-doped fibre amplifiers (EDFAs), 5 Gbit/s optical transmission terminal equipment provides better than -40 dBm receiver sensitivity at a BER of 10-11. The experiments focused on the FEC feature of the removal of the BER floor together with long-distance repeaterless transmission
